1,028,430 is a composite number, even.
1,028,430 (one million twenty-eight thousand four hundred thirty) is an even 7-digit number. It is a composite number with 64 divisors, and factors as 2 × 3³ × 5 × 13 × 293. Its proper divisors sum to 1,935,090,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xFB14E.
